首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android Webview将内容显示为原始HTML

Android WebView是Android系统提供的一个组件,用于在应用程序中显示网页内容。它可以将网页内容以原始HTML的形式展示给用户。

Android WebView的主要功能包括:

  1. 显示网页内容:Android WebView可以加载并显示网页内容,包括HTML、CSS、JavaScript等。
  2. 支持交互操作:用户可以在WebView中进行网页的点击、滚动、缩放等操作,实现与网页的交互。
  3. 支持网页加载进度和错误处理:WebView可以显示网页加载的进度条,并提供错误处理机制,例如当网页加载失败时可以显示错误页面或执行相应的操作。
  4. 支持与原生应用的交互:WebView提供了JavaScript与原生应用程序之间的通信接口,可以实现网页与应用程序的数据交换和功能调用。
  5. 支持本地存储:WebView可以访问本地存储,包括本地数据库、文件系统等,方便网页与应用程序之间的数据交互。

Android WebView的应用场景包括但不限于:

  1. 内嵌网页浏览器:开发者可以在应用程序中嵌入WebView,实现内嵌网页浏览器的功能,方便用户在应用内浏览网页。
  2. 嵌入第三方网页内容:应用程序可以通过WebView加载第三方网页内容,例如展示新闻、文章、广告等。
  3. 实现Hybrid App:Hybrid App是指结合了Web技术和原生应用技术的应用程序,通过WebView可以实现Web页面和原生应用的混合开发,提供更丰富的用户体验。

腾讯云相关产品中与Android WebView相关的产品包括:

  1. 腾讯云移动浏览器:腾讯云移动浏览器是一款基于Chromium内核的移动浏览器,可以在应用程序中嵌入WebView,提供稳定、安全的网页浏览体验。产品介绍链接:https://cloud.tencent.com/product/tcb
  2. 腾讯云移动推送:腾讯云移动推送可以实现应用程序的消息推送功能,包括网页推送通知。开发者可以通过WebView加载推送的网页内容,实现消息的展示和交互。产品介绍链接:https://cloud.tencent.com/product/tpns

以上是关于Android WebView的概念、分类、优势、应用场景以及腾讯云相关产品的介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 产品经理简单了解技术之Webview

    在产品经理实现App功能时,经常会和IOS开发、安卓开发、前端开发一起讨论问题,是因为应用功能的实现开发可以分为两种:客户端开发和HTML5 移动端开发(简称H5开发)。H5开发指通过HTML5 + CSS + JS来构建一个网页版的应用,而中间的媒介就是Webview。内嵌Webview在应用开发中占据着重要的地位,它能以较低的成本实现Android、IOS、Web的复用,并且可以突破苹果的热更新封锁。但是Webview带来便捷的同时,同时Web的性能和体验也存在缺陷。给人最大的体验就是打开速度比native慢。打开打开一个WebView页面,页面往往会慢慢加载很久,若干秒后才出现你所需要看到的页面。在目前的工作中,部分产品功能是前端开发基于Webview进行实现,因此进行一个简单的了解。

    02
    领券